Located in Crawford County, Kansas, Walnut is a community with a population of 230. The median household income of $53,661 is above the Crawford County median ($50,311).
From 2019 to 2023, Walnut's population grew 25.7% from 183 to 230, while its median home value rose 72.0% from $15,000 to $25,800.
79.0% of homes are single-family detached houses. The typical home was built around 1942.
